PDO vs MySQLi:硬核开发者的选择之道
硬件朋克从不玩虚的,代码也一样。PDO和MySQLi,都是PHP连接数据库的工具,但真正懂行的人一眼就能看出差别。 PDO是面向对象的,但别被那层糖衣骗了。它支持多种数据库,这是它的优势,也是它的软肋。当你需要极致性能的时候,这种抽象层可能就成了累赘。 MySQLi则是专为MySQL而生,底层更贴近原生API。它没有那么多花里胡哨的功能,但每一次调用都像直接操作硬件一样精准。这就是硬核开发者的偏好。 有人喜欢PDO的预处理语句,觉得它安全又方便。但真正的高手知道,SQL注入不是靠框架解决的,而是靠对数据的严格校验和逻辑的严谨性。 MySQLi的函数式编程风格更适合那些喜欢掌控每一行代码的人。你不会被封装好的类所束缚,而是能直接操控查询过程,就像在电路板上焊接元件一样。 AI绘图结果,仅供参考 不要被“现代”这个词迷惑。有时候,最古老的工具才是最可靠的。PDO虽然新,但它的多数据库支持更像是个噱头,而MySQLi才是真正能让你深入系统内部的钥匙。 硬核开发者不需要太多选择,他们只需要一个能让他们掌控一切的工具。MySQLi就是那个工具,它不喧哗,不浮夸,只专注于一件事——高效、稳定地与MySQL交互。 所以别再纠结了。如果你真的想成为硬核开发者,那就选MySQLi。它不会让你失望,就像一台老式机器不会因为年代久远就失去力量。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|